WHAT LIFT REPAIR COVERS
Lift repair covers a wide range of remedial work — from replacing worn components to rectifying faults identified during servicing, shutdowns, inspections or third-party recommendations. Unlike emergency call-outs (urgent response to active breakdowns), lift repair is scheduled, planned work focused on corrective action and ongoing reliability.

REPAIRS ARISING FROM INSPECTIONS & RECOMMENDATIONS
Many repair works follow routine servicing, fault investigation, LOLER thorough examination findings or insurer recommendations. Where defects, wear or performance issues are identified, scheduled repair works restore the lift to reliable, compliant operation.
This includes works recommended during service visits, reported faults between visits, shutdown investigations, ageing equipment issues, and defect items flagged during external LOLER examination. TRACTION & HYDRAULIC LIFT REPAIRS
Our engineers work on both traction and hydraulic systems - and both require different repair approaches.
Traction lifts
Repairs often centre on door equipment (the single biggest cause of lift call-outs), controller components, drive electronics, levelling accuracy, suspension ropes and brake systems. Mid-rise residential and commercial buildings across London are typically traction, either geared (older) or gearless/MRL (newer).
Hydraulic lifts
Repairs often cover pump unit faults, valve block issues, ram seal leaks, pipework corrosion, door equipment and control faults. Common in 2–7 storey retail, commercial, healthcare and mixed-use buildings across London and Essex.
By diagnosing the issue properly and recommending the right corrective work, most lift repairs improve reliability substantially without jumping to full modernisation or replacement.
